Set against the backdrop of wartime Kingston Upon Hull, a tragic bombing leaves sixteen-year-old Charlotte orphaned and alone. She is taken in by her estranged Aunt Hilda in a quiet Yorkshire village, where tensions arise due to hidden family resentments. As Charlotte adjusts to her new life, she finds purpose caring for French orphans and becomes entangled with a dashing Free French officer, Emile. Together, they must confront their pasts and unravel family secrets to forge a path toward happiness amidst the chaos of war.
